When I clone the males I like I flower them out till day 20+ couple of days before they drop pollen chop all the tops off and nice branches and plop them in water over paper. The pollen will fall onto the paper and you will remove all plant material from it until only pure pollen is left. Then pack it up in tin foil packets and pop it in the fridge. Put some desiccant or rice to keep it dry and make sure the jar seals I used curing jars. I am pretty sure you can freeze it too, but check to make sure I always use it within 3 months.
